Blaise Veterinary Referral Hospital, IVC Evidensia’s newest hospital in Birmingham, is celebrating its first anniversary this month.
Since its opening in November 2023, Blaise Referral Hospital has seen more than 7,000 patients, including over 2,000 cats and 4,200 dogs.
Nova the Dalmatian puppy was rushed to the hospital after developing a rare, abnormal ear condition called congenital aural atresia. If left untreated, her condition would have led to infections, an abscess, and hearing problems.
Thanks to the expertise of surgeon Lara Dempsey, the soft tissue surgery team could preserve Nova’s trademark floppy Dalmatian ear. The team performed total ear canal ablation and a lateral bulla osteotomy, which involved removing the dog’s external ear canal and making a window in the bulla.
Bernie the dog was brought in to the neurology team with a slipped disc in his neck. As a result, he suffered from leg paralysis and difficulty breathing.
To save him, surgeons performed a ventral slot procedure in which the disc material was successfully removed. The emergency and critical care team then supported the patient with a ventilator for two days, providing postoperative care and tailored physiotherapy. After two weeks, Bernie’s movement and breathing were restored, and he was discharged, tail wagging.
Over the last year, more than 100 hours of CPD have been delivered to veterinarians and nurses in the hospital’s modern facilities, covering a variety of disciplines. This includes orthopaedics, emergency triage, and cardiology.
Blaise Referral has also rolled out its internship programme and welcomed its first cohort of interns to the team. Within 12 months, interns are exposed to different areas of the hospital, rotating through surgery, medicine, anaesthesia, neurology, and out-of-hours care.
